In the quiet, dreamlike realm of Frida Kahlo’s “Untitled,” the viewer is invited into a space where the boundaries between nature and the subconscious dissolve. The painting presents a decept and profoundly evocative scene: a solitary bird perched with delicate grace beside a plant bearing vibrant purple leaves. This juxtaposition immediately captures the eye, establishing an intimate dialogue between fragility and vitality. Kahlo meticulously crafted this composition to convey more than mere visual beauty; she weaves an underlying narrative of perseverance against adversity, where every element serves as a silent witness to the strength found within vulnerability.
The artwork is a masterful specimen of Surrealism, a movement that sought to liberate the imagination from the rigid constraints of rational thought. Rather than adhering to traditional landscape or portraiture, Kahlo utilizes dreamlike imagery to tap into the deeper recesses of the human psyche. Through her deliberate use of oil on canvas, she achieves a palpable physicality. The brushstrokes are textured and intentional, creating a sense of immediacy that draws the observer closer. A careful layering of colors provides a luminous depth, making the purple hues of the leaves and the soft plumage of the bird appear to glow from within, much like a memory surfacing from a dream.
To understand this piece is to understand the historical heartbeat of post-revolutionary Mexico. Created during a period of intense social upheaval and artistic experimentation, “Untitled” reflects a nation grappling with its identity. The bird, often interpreted as a symbol of freedom, hope, and spiritual ascension, stands in poignant contrast to the physical limitations Kahlo endured throughout her life. This tension between the lightness of flight and the grounded reality of existence is what gives the painting its profound emotional resonance.
